Hospitaler Definition
 häspit'lər 
    noun
  
 A member of a religious military society (Knights of Malta) organized during the Middle Ages to care for the sick and needy.
 Webster's New World 
A member of any of several religious orders dedicated to the care of sick or needy persons.

Origin of Hospitaler
-  
Middle English Hospiteler from Old French hospitalier from Medieval Latin hospitālārius giver of hospitality from hospitāle hospice hospital
